QA Engineer

3 days ago


Cape Town, South Africa DataFin Full time

ENVIRONMENT:

JOIN the expanding team of a fast-growing FinTech company seeking a highly skilled QA Engineer. You will create, develop, and implement comprehensive test plans, test cases, and test scripts to guarantee the quality and performance of software products while identifying & thoroughly documenting software defects and ensuring the delivery of the highest quality product possible. You will require a Bachelor's Degree in Computer Science/Software Engineering, or a related field, prior work experience as a Quality Assurance Engineer or a similar role with expertise in QA software methodologies, tools, and processes with proficiency QA tools such as Jira, API and Test Management platforms & hands-on experience with test automation tools and frameworks, such as Cypress, Newman, and the BDD Cucumber framework.

DUTIES:

1. Collaborate effectively: Work closely with cross-functional teams, including Developers, Product Managers, and Designers, to gain a clear understanding of product requirements and functionalities.
2. Plan, develop, and execute tests: Create, develop, and implement comprehensive test plans, test cases, and test scripts to guarantee the quality and performance of software products.
3. Conduct thorough testing: Perform Manual and Automated Testing on web and API integrations, mobile applications, and other software components.
4. Defect identification and resolution: Identify and thoroughly document software defects, inconsistencies, and issues, then collaborate with the Development team to rectify them.
5. Enhance Automated Testing: Continuously improve and maintain automated test suites to expand test coverage and optimise efficiency.
6. Regression Testing: Ensure that new features or changes do not negatively impact existing functionality by conducting Regression Testing.
7. Refine requirements and user stories: Participate in the review and refinement of product requirements and user stories to uncover potential gaps and ambiguities.
8. Stay informed: Keep yourself up-to-date with industry best practices and emerging trends in quality assurance and test automation.

REQUIREMENTS:

Qualifications:

- Bachelor's Degree in Computer Science, Software Engineering, or a related field.

Experience/Skills:

- Previous experience as a Quality Assurance Engineer or similar role with expertise in QA software methodologies, tools, and processes.
- Strong understanding of QA testing processes, including manual and automated testing techniques.
- Knowledge of the Software Development Lifecycle and testing frameworks such as Agile.
- Experience with popular QA tools such as Jira, API and Test Management platforms.
- Proficiency in testing web applications, APIs and mobile apps (iOS and Android).
- Hands-on experience with test automation tools and frameworks, such as Cypress, Newman, and the BDD Cucumber framework.

Advantageous:

- Familiarity with programming languages like Java, TypeScript or Python.

ATTRIBUTES:

- Good communication and collaboration skills, enabling effective teamwork within cross-functional groups.
- Great analytical and problem-solving abilities with meticulous attention to detail.
- Capability to grasp and apply technical concepts and demonstrate strong cognitive skills.

#J-18808-Ljbffr



  • Cape Town, South Africa Dijkstrack Full time

    We are a UK-based development agency, specializing in delivering customized solutions to our diverse portfolio of international clients ranging from FinTech, Crypto and Start-ups. With a focus on innovation and excellence, we are expanding our team and seeking experienced QA Automation Engineers. What’s in it for you? - We are remote first. - An...


  • Cape Town, Western Cape, South Africa PRR Recruitment Services Full time

    Senior QA Automation EngineerThis fast-growing fintech B2B SaaS business is on a mission to streamline the lifecycle of structured product & private asset deals. We are looking for a Senior QA Automation Engineer to join our team.Key Responsibilities:System test-related activitiesInvestigate test automation toolsFunctional and integration testingMonitor...

  • QA Automation Engineer

    4 months ago


    Cape Town, South Africa Dijkstrack Full time

    We are a UK-based development agency, specializing in delivering customized solutions to our diverse portfolio of international clients ranging from FinTech, Crypto and Start-up's. With a focus on innovation and excellence, we are expanding our team and seeking experienced QA Automation EngineersWhat's in it for you? We are remote first.An...

  • Senior QA Engineer

    2 weeks ago


    Cape Town, South Africa Lula Full time

    Job title: Senior QA Engineer Reporting to: AQ Manager Location: Our Lula head office is based in Cape Town; however, for this role, we are open to applications from across South Africa.  ALL STAFF APPOINTMENTS WILL BE MADE WITH DUE CONSIDERATION OF THE COMPANY'S EE TARGETS WHAT WE DO Lula is an...

  • Senior QA Engineer

    1 month ago


    Cape Town, South Africa Lula Full time

    ALL STAFF APPOINTMENTS WILL BE MADE WITH DUE CONSIDERATION OF THE COMPANY'S EE TARGETS WHAT WE DO Lula is an innovative and human-focused FinTech company on a mission to help small businesses optimise their cash flow. Our purpose is to help SMEs manage their businesses better, faster, and more simply, so they can spend more time doing...


  • Cape Town, South Africa JenRec Recruitment Full time

    They are a leading provider of business automation software, helping businesses to streamline their operations and improve efficiency. They comprised of talented and dedicated individuals who are committed to delivering exceptional results for their clients. Our Test Automation Architect RoleAre you a highly motivated and as a Test Automation Enigineer? In...

  • QA Engineer

    2 weeks ago


    Cape Town, South Africa Adzuna ZA B C2 Full time

    As a QA Engineer, you will play a critical role in the product development process by designing and implementing tests, debugging code, and defining corrective actions. Youll be responsible for reviewing system and feature requirements, applying the best testing practices, and conducting tests prior to product launches. Your work will directly ensure our...

  • QA Engineer

    2 weeks ago


    Cape Town, South Africa Communicate Recruitment Full time

    As a QA Engineer, you will play a critical role in the product development process by designing and implementing tests, debugging code, and defining corrective actions. Youll be responsible for reviewing system and feature requirements, applying the best testing practices, and conducting tests prior to product launches. Your work will directly ensure our...

  • QA Engineer

    2 weeks ago


    Cape Town, South Africa Communicate Recruitment Full time

    As a QA Engineer, you will play a critical role in the product development process by designing and implementing tests, debugging code, and defining corrective actions. Youll be responsible for reviewing system and feature requirements, applying the best testing practices, and conducting tests prior to product launches. Your work will directly ensure our...

  • QA Engineer

    2 weeks ago


    Cape Town, South Africa Communicate Recruitment Full time

    As a QA Engineer, you will play a critical role in the product development process by designing and implementing tests, debugging code, and defining corrective actions. Youll be responsible for reviewing system and feature requirements, applying the best testing practices, and conducting tests prior to product launches. Your work will directly ensure our...

  • QA Engineer

    5 months ago


    Cape Town, South Africa MRI Software Full time

    From the day we opened our doors in 1971, MRI Software has built flexible, game-changing real estate software solutions to improve people’s lives. The only way to carry out that mission is to hire the absolute best employees on earth. People like you. Work hard, play hard. Always. Our relentless commitment to client success, our employee resource groups...

  • QA Engineer

    5 days ago


    Cape Town City Centre, South Africa Jobted ZA C2 Full time

    As a QA Engineer, you will play a critical role in the product development process by designing and implementing tests, debugging code, and defining corrective actions. Youll be responsible for reviewing system and feature requirements, applying the best testing practices, and conducting tests prior to product launches. Your work will directly ensure our...


  • Cape Town, South Africa Progressive Edge Full time

    Mobile Applications QA EngineerCape Town (Hybrid)A Fintech company has a new role available for Mobile Applications QA Engineer to join their Team. The organisation builds and offers various products and services for small and medium enterprises.Overall PurposeAs a seasoned Mobile QA Engineer, the overall purpose is to ensure the quality and functionality of...

  • QA Analyst

    4 months ago


    Cape Town, South Africa eKomi Full time

    iAbout Us: eKomi, The Feedback Company, is a leading provider of customer feedback and review management services. Our mission is to help businesses harness the power of authentic customer feedback to build trust and improve their products and services. We are looking for a meticulous and highly skilled QA Operator to join our dynamic team. **Key...

  • QA Manager

    4 months ago


    Cape Town, South Africa redPanda Software Full time

    **About redPanda Software** redPanda Software is a Retail Software Solutions company, with clients locally and internationally. Our offerings include various products and bespoke cloud, mobile and enterprise solutions, and managed services. Our strength is our rich retail background and experience, our technical abilities and our core values, **Pride,...

  • QA Lead

    6 months ago


    Cape Town, South Africa THE SKILLS MINE (PTY) LTD Full time

    **Responsibilities** - Leading and monitoring the QA team in the development and execution of comprehensive testing strategies and methodologies - Oversee the daily operations of the testing team, ensuring all tasks are tested thoroughly - Create and implement testing strategies and methodologies that align with the company's goals and objectives - Develop...

  • Senior QA Engineer

    3 weeks ago


    Western Cape, South Africa Goldman Tech Resourcing Full time

    Are you a senior QA Engineer looking for a new opportunity? This could be for you Requirements: · Bachelors degree in computer science, Engineering, or related field. · 7 years experience as a Quality Assurance Engineer. · Strong understanding of software testing methodologies, tools, and techniques. Hands-on experience with project management tools, for...


  • Cape Town, Western Cape, South Africa Dijkstrack Full time

    Unlock Your Potential as a QA Automation EngineerWe are a UK-based development agency, Dijkstrack, specializing in delivering customized solutions to our diverse portfolio of international clients ranging from FinTech, Crypto, and Start-ups. With a focus on innovation and excellence, we are expanding our team and seeking experienced QA Automation...

  • QA Advisor

    5 days ago


    Cape Town, South Africa Jobted ZA C2 Full time

    Overview Hire Resolve is currently seeking a dedicated QA Advisor to join our client’s team in Cape Town. As a leading recruitment agency, we focus on placing quality professionals in reputable organizations, and we pride ourselves on matching the right talent to the right positions. In this role, you will work closely with various teams to ensure...

  • QA Advisor

    5 days ago


    Cape Town, South Africa Jobted ZA C2 Full time

    Overview Hire Resolve is on the lookout for a QA Advisor based in Cape Town to enhance our client’s quality assurance initiatives. The QA Advisor will play a crucial role in ensuring that the quality assurance framework aligns with industry standards and regulatory requirements. Responsibilities - Provide assistance on quality issues across all business...